Output 73f8a76b2eddcd68df8031879eb2b4613ea4e69162f1083ba8474653e007829c:3

value
33098883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e12b4693acad692fecef573cb8675d259f9cb60c OP_EQUAL
address
MURk7STZDiAhashtVJRDKYDPRbMr6J1Di9
transaction
73f8a76b2eddcd68df8031879eb2b4613ea4e69162f1083ba8474653e007829c
spent
true